Hornets' Dwight Howard double-doubles, blocks 4 shots against Mavs
Charlotte Hornets center Dwight Howard accounted for 15 points, 12 rebounds and 4 blocks in Wednesday's 115-111 loss to the Dallas Mavericks.
Howard got up just five field goal attempts, but he made all five. Unfortunately, he was completely off from the free throw line, as he finished 5-for-18 from the stripe in 35.3 minutes. He saved the day with his blocks, in addition to two assists and a steal.
Averaging 34.8 FanDuel points per game, Howard produced 44.4 FD points at a cost of $8,700. numberFire's models project him to play 30.5 minutes and tally 33.7 FD points in a meeting with the Utah Jazz Friday night.
